How Much Costs Foundation Repair Really Come To?
Determining the precise cost of foundation repair can be a bit like trying to predict the weather—it depends on a multitude of factors. The scope of the damage, the nature of repair needed, and your region's specific regulations can all significantly impact the overall price tag. As a rule of thumb, a minor crack repair might run you somewhere between $500 and $1,500, while more severe repairs could easily reach tens of thousands of dollars.

Tackling vs. Professional Foundation Repair: Cost Considerations
When facing foundation troubles, homeowners often question whether to tackle the repairs independently or engage a expert contractor. Both options have distinct monetary implications.
DIY foundation repair can seem appealing due to its opportunity for savings. However, it's crucial to consider the hidden costs of supplies, which can quickly increase. Additionally, without proper expertise, DIY repairs tend to result in subpar work, leading to further damage and even higher repair expenses down the road.
Professional foundation repair, while initially more costly, offers several benefits. Licensed contractors have the skillset to accurately identify the concern and implement efficient solutions. They also have the necessary tools and equipment to complete the job safely. Furthermore, professional contractors often provide warranties on their work, providing peace of mind against future issues.

Foundation Repair Financing Options to Consider Explore
A solid foundation is crucial for your home's structural integrity. Sadly, when foundation problems arise, the cost of repair can be daunting. Fortunately, there are various financing options available to make these repairs more manageable. Think about a few different approaches to find the best fit for your situation.
One popular option is a home equity loan or line of credit (HELOC). This allows you to borrow funds based on the equity you have in your home. Another option is a personal loan, which offers a fixed interest rate and monthly payments. Numerous lenders specialize in financing home repairs, so you may be able to find a program with attractive terms.
It's important to thoroughly compare different financing options before making a decision. Pay attention factors such as interest rates, loan terms, and repayment schedules. Moreover, don't hesitate to speak to a financial advisor to get personalized recommendations.
